Early Life and Rise to Fame

Emory Jones, born on April 23, 1971, in the United States, is a prominent figure in American hip-hop and streetwear fashion. His career took off in the 1990s when he partnered with his friend Jay Z to create a successful business empire. Together, they founded Roc Nation Lifestyle, a design company that became a major player in the fashion industry.

Before achieving success in the fashion world, Jones faced a significant setback in his life. In the year 2000, he was convicted of cocaine trafficking charges and sentenced to 16 years in prison. Despite this difficult period, Jones remained determined to turn his life around and make a name for himself in the fashion industry.

Partnership with PUMA and 'Bet on Yourself' Clothing Line

In 2017, Jones made a triumphant return to the fashion scene when he partnered with PUMA to release his "Bet on Yourself" clothing line. The collaboration was a huge success, showcasing Jones' unique sense of style and his ability to create trendy and innovative designs. The clothing line quickly gained popularity among fans of streetwear fashion and further solidified Jones' reputation as a fashion mogul.
